Gate array:
The gate array listed below is one of the control circuit chips. Installed parts on the outside of the gate
array form one control and drive circuit.
E0521AA (MMU: Memory Management Unit, 8B)
The E05A21 AA MMU provides the following functions on a single chip. According to these functions,
the expanded memory area of the main control circuit can be controlled without complicated circuitry.
•
Lower address position latched output
•
Bank latch, output
•
Bit operand
•
MMIO decode, output
•
CG, Program, Ram decode
•
Reset for internal/external program change or replacement
•
ON LINE/OFF LINE process (switch)
E05A24GA (PIF: Parallel Interface Controller, 12C)
This E05A24GA PIF provides the following functions on a single chip. According
to these functions, interfacing between the main control circuit and the host
can be controlled without complicated circuitry.
•
Parallel interface data latch (lead) and output to the printer.
•
Latch timing selection is possible.
•
Set, reset, and lead of control signals (ACK, BUSY, ERROR, etc.)
•
INIT signal latch from the host and output to the printer
•
READY lamp ON/OFF
•
RXD signal exchange (serial interface)
•
I/O sensor and switch signal reading (LOAD/EJECT, RL) and drive signal output (LOAD/EJECT
lamp, Release solenoid)
E05A22EA (PHC: Print Head Controller, GB)
This E05A22EA PHC provides the following functions on a single chip. According to these functions,
all of the print head drive controls can be controlled without complicated circuitry.
•
Head data latch
•
Head (piezo solenoid) charge/discharge control (timing, power range)
•
Direct control of the dot data to the head nozzle line (vertical dot pitch control)
•
Half protect
•
Print timing sample
•
I/O sensor signal reading (IE,ICE,TE,PE,CSF) and pump unit control signal output (pump motor,
valve solenoid)
E05A23GC (DCU: DC Motor Control Unit, 4B)
This E05A23GC DCU is a gate array that carries out all of the main printer carriage motor controls on
a single chip, and it provides the functions listed below. The DCU is connected to the carriage motor
drive circuit, motor encoder,and the carriage home-position sensor, and according to these, performs
carriage motor positioning, speed control, and print timing generation without complicated circuitry.
